ResumoAfter a successful launch of the Japanese Medium-Scale Broadcasting Satellite for Experimental Purpose (BSE) "Yuri" in April 1978, check-outs of the satellite and the transponder were conducted by the National Space development Agency of Japan (NASDA) for three months. In July, Radio Research Laboratories (RRL) of the Ministry of Posts and Telecommunications (MOPT) and Nippon Hoso Kyokai (NHK: Japan Broadcasting Corporation) initiated various kinds of satellite broadcasting experiments which will be continued for three years. This paper presents brief description of the BSE program and the preliminary results of the experiments.
